A Graduate Certificate in Storytelling for Hybrid Work Environments equips professionals with the crucial communication skills needed to thrive in today's dynamic workplaces. This program focuses on crafting compelling narratives that resonate across diverse teams, regardless of location.
Learning outcomes include mastering techniques for digital storytelling, developing engaging presentations for virtual and in-person audiences, and effectively utilizing various media platforms for internal and external communication. You'll learn to adapt your storytelling approach for hybrid settings, fostering inclusivity and collaboration. This involves understanding the nuances of remote communication and leveraging technology to enhance narrative impact.
The program duration is typically designed for working professionals, offering flexible scheduling options and often completing within 12 months. Specific program length may vary, so check individual institution details for accurate information.
This Graduate Certificate is highly relevant for professionals in diverse industries, including marketing, human resources, public relations, and education. Strong storytelling skills are increasingly valuable in today’s job market, benefiting anyone needing to communicate effectively across geographically dispersed teams. The skills learned are directly applicable to leadership roles, project management, and employee engagement initiatives, further enhancing career prospects.
Graduates of this certificate program are prepared to navigate the challenges of communication in hybrid work models, leveraging the power of narrative to drive engagement, improve teamwork, and achieve organizational goals. This includes the ability to create employee training materials, company newsletters, and other content to communicate successfully within a blended workforce.
